WebTo solve these problems, we study a cloud-edge based hybrid smart grid fault detection system. Embedded devices are placed at the edge of the monitored equipment with several lightweight neural networks for fault detection. WebJan 26, 2024 · Smart Grid: A smart grid is an electricity network based on digital technology that is used to supply electricity to consumers via two-way digital communication.
